Zusammenfassung:Rembrandt is renowned for his impasto, a paint with outstanding rheological properties, the exact formulation of which has remained a mystery. In their Communication on page 5619 ff., V. Gonzalez et al. used synchrotron X‐ray diffraction to investigate microscopic samples from Rembrandt masterpieces; a rare lead compound, plumbonacrite (Pb5(CO3)3O(OH)2), was detected in the impasto. This constitutes the fingerprint of Rembrandt's recipe, shedding light on the Master's pictorial technique.
